I'm not sdpaso, but I can tell you.

Once upon a time there was a breed of horse called a "Tiger". It had spots like the Appy, but the gait of a Paso Fino. In an effort to recreate that breed, there are a select few who are crossing gaited Appys with the Pasos. My friend, sdpaso, is (I think) the only one doing it here in Canada. I know a woman in the States who is, and I know OF another woman in the States who is.

Her Appy colt is just coming two years old now. He's going to be HUGE and he is what they call a "few spot", which, essentially, means that whatever mare he covers, the baby WILL have spots. Now we're waiting to see that the gait remains and that his conformation stays true as he matures. Assuming everything's a "go", sdpaso will (hopefully) have her first Tiger babies on the ground next year.
